Curriculum Resource Centre Collections

The CRC maintains a current collection of quality teaching resources at all levels for the use of student teachers. Student teachers are able to evaluate a range of resources used in schools and in education generally and access the resources for their Professional Internship.

The Collection includes:

  • Curriculum Framework documents for Western Australia
  • Many activities and ideas books for classroom lesson preparation
  • Videos and DVDs for class viewing
  • Educational software for evaluation
  • Teaching kits to support the learning areas
  • Posters and focus packs for all learning areas
  • Puppets to support a range of stories and themes
  • Educational games
  • Early childhood learning objects
  • Learning objects to support all learning areas
  • A selection of primary and young adult fiction
  • A collection of picture books
  • Big books and guided reading packs

The Collection does not include:

  • Texts which are located in the University Library
  • Blackline masters for copying only
  • Tests other than a few samples

Students are also encouraged to make use of complementary collections of resources:

Reciprocal access is available to the Western Australian Department of Education and Training Library. Students should take proof of current enrolment at Murdoch University and their student card.

The Murdoch University Library has a collection of fiction as well as texts suitable for secondary education.

Public libraries are an excellent source of fiction and non fiction.

The One World Centre can be accessed for multicultural and indigenous educational resources. A small annual fee is charged.
